Carder, Broncos Down Falcons, 45-21

Alex Carder used both his arm and his legs to lift host Western Michigan University to a 45-21 win over the Bowling Green State University football team Saturday afternoon (Oct. 8). The Mid-American Conference game was held at Waldo Stadium.
With the win, the Broncos improve to 4-2 overall, and WMU is now 2-0 in the MAC. BGSU drops to 3-3 and 1-1, respectively.
Carder threw for 212 yards and three touchdowns, and also ran for a career-high 95 yards and another score. He completed 18 passes in 26 attempts on the day.
Jordan White had 12 receptions for 156 yards, and caught two of Carder's three TD tosses.
As a team, the Broncos rolled up 578 yards of total offense, including 351 on the ground. The Falcons' 381 total years included 263 threw the air and 118 on the ground.
After holding the Falcons to a three-and-out on the game's first possession, Carder led the Broncos on a 65-yard scoring drive. The Bronco QB rushed for 52 of those 65 yards, including the final yard into the end zone.
BGSU, however, quickly responded, as Matt Schilz directed the Falcons on a three-play, 77-yard drive. The last of those three plays came after the redshirt sophomore QB faked a handoff to freshman Anthon Samuel, then completed a pass to a wide-open Kamar Jorden for a 57-yard touchdown. After Stephen Stein's extra point was good, the game was tied, 7-7, with just under six minutes gone.
After the teams exchanged punts, the Broncos regained the lead on Tevin Drake's 12-yard run. The hosts held the Falcons again, and WMU was driving again when freshman Darrell Hunter intercepted Carder on the first play of the second quarter.
The Falcons responded with a 73-yard drive, culminating with Samuel's 5-yard run. Stein's PAT knotted the score at 14-all with 9:22 left before halftime.
Back came the Broncos, though. Brian Fields broke free for a 53-yard run to the BGSU 16, and Carder found White for 15 more yards to the one-yard line. On the next play, Carder hit Chris Prom for a score, giving the hosts the lead for good.
The Falcons went 60 yards on the ensuing drive, reaching the WMU 18-yard line before turning the ball over on downs. Western took over with 2:49 left in the half, and drove downfield to take a two-score lead for the first time in the game. Carder completed five of his seven passes on that drive, finding White for a 9-yard score with 30.8 seconds left before halftime. The PAT gave Western a 28-14 lead at the intermission.
On the opening drive of the second half, the hosts drove down to the BGSU 18 before the Falcon defense held. Paul Swan forced Carder to throw the ball away on second down, and Kevin Moore then sacked the Western QB on third down. The Broncos were forced to settle for a John Potter field goal, giving the hosts a 31-14 lead.
The Falcons were forced to punt on the next possession, and Carder and the Broncos salted the game away with a nine-play, 66-yard drive. That drive took nearly five minutes, and saw Carder hit White again, for a 26-yard score. The point-after try gave the Broncos a 38-14 advantage.
WMU would score again, with a 51-yard run by Drake leading to a one-yard TD run by Antoin Scriven early in the fourth quarter. Jamel Martin's four-yard run and Stein's PAT closed the scoring with 2:30 left.
Schilz threw for 194 yards in the game, completing 15 of his 25 passes. He had one touchdown toss and did not throw an interception.
Eugene Cooper led BG with nine receptions, totaling 72 yards, while Jorden had a team-high 103 receiving yards on four catches.
Samuel led the Falcons on the ground, with 59 yards on his 14 carries.
WMU's rushing total included 112 yards on just 10 carries by Drake. Carder, as mentioned, had 95 yards on the ground, while Fields ran for 79 yards on nine tries.
The Falcons return home to face the University of Toledo next Saturday (Oct. 15). Kickoff is scheduled for 12:00 p.m. at Doyt L. Perry Stadium.
